爱奇艺二面面经

一面 20min

  1. 介绍项目

  2. Android布局嵌套深有什么问题

  3. kotlin协程

  4. HashMap原理

  5. 算法:手写快排

二面60min

  1. Activity启动模式

  2. Activity A → B的生命周期在这四种启动模式下的状态

  3. 广播类型

  4. 有序广播如何实现的按顺序收到广播

  5. 持久化存储方式

  6. SharedPreferences的格式

  7. xml解析方式

  8. json与xml的区别,json为什么比xml更好

  9. Android view绘制流程

  10. surfaceView

  11. sp, dp, px的区别

  12. 机型大小适配

  13. 适配语言

  14. ANR 什么时候出现,如何排查

  15. Android 动画

  16. startService与bindService的区别

  17. Service保活方式

  18. java泛型,<? extends T>能否add元素

  19. 重写equals方法需要重写hashCode方法吗

  20. ThreadLocal

  21. wait,sleep,yield,join的区别

  22. 算法1:字符串全排列

  23. 算法2:删除链表中倒数第n个节点

#2022届秋招进度交流##爱奇艺##安卓工程师##面经#
全部评论
老哥,你爱奇艺啥时候面的啊?我9.12笔试完没消息了...😂
点赞 回复 分享
发布于 2021-10-01 00:16
确实大佬
点赞 回复 分享
发布于 2021-09-27 17:01
大佬大佬
点赞 回复 分享
发布于 2021-09-27 14:33

相关推荐

xiaolihuam...:当然还有一种情况是你多次一面挂,并且挂的原因都比较类似,例如每次都是算法题写不出来。面试官给你的评价大概率是算法能力有待加强,算法能力有待提高,基础知识掌握的不错,项目过关,但是coding要加强。短期内高强度面试并且每次都是因为同样的原因挂(这个你自己肯定很清楚),会形成刻板印象,因为你偶尔一次算法写不出来,面试官自己也能理解,因为他清楚的知道自己出去面试也不一定每一次面试算法都能写出来。但是连续几次他发现你的面屏里面都是算法有问题,他就认为这不是运气问题,而是能力问题,这种就是很客观的评价形成了刻白印象,所以你要保证自己。至少不能连续几次面试犯同样的错。算法这个东西比较难保证,但是有些东西是可以的,例如某一轮你挂的时候是因为数据库的索引,这个知识点答的不好,那你就要把数据库整体系统性的复习,下一轮面试你可以,项目打的不好,可以消息队列答的不好,但是绝对不可以数据库再答的不好了。当然事实上对于任何面试都应该这样查漏补缺,只是对于字节来说这个格外重要,有些面试官真的会问之前面试官问过的问题
点赞 评论 收藏
分享
评论
1
17
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务